VMWare
De MEPIS Documentation Wiki
Tabla de contenidos |
Introducción
VMWare es una aplicación de virtualización de escritorio o maquina virtual usado por desarrolladores o testeadores de software y profesionales de las TIC para ejecutar multiples sistemas opeartivos de forma simultánea en un único ordenador. Por ejemplo se puede ejecutar Windows dentro de VMWare en MEPIS, o probar distintas distribuciones de Linux si necesidad de reiniciar MEPIS.
Requisitos y consideraciones de rendimiento
Hay que tener en cuenta que se estarán ejecutarndo dos (o más) Sistemas Operativos simultáneamente, por lo que esta decisión influirá en el rendimiento. Normalmente el sistema operativo virtual (sistema operativo huesped) funcionará más lento que si fuera el sistema operativo anfitrión. Y que cuando el sistema operativo virtual/huesped está ejecutantdose, usará memoria reduciendo así la memoria disponible para el sistema operativo anfitrión (Linux, en nuestro caso). Si por ejemplo el equipo tiene 1.0 GB de memoria principal, el sistema operativo anfitrión tendrá la mitad y el sistema operativo huesped la otra mitad, o 3/4 el sistema operativo anfitrión y 1/4 el huesped o cualquier otra combinación -- se puede cambiar/configurar el tamaño de la memoria como se desee.
También se necesitará espacion en el disco para la MV. Por defecto cuando the crea la MV para ejecutar WinXP como sistema operativo huesped, solicitará 8GB de espacio en el disco (pero se puede reducir, por ejemplo 5GB). Por defecto, VMWare-server tomará este espcio en disco del 'directorio raiz' de Linux (pero se dispone de control sobre la ubicación por lo que se puede configurar para que utilice espacio de algún lugar de la carpeta 'home' si se prefiere).
Productos gratuitos
Se puede elegir entre [dos] productos:
Ambos pueden ejecutar MVs, sin embargo tienen caracteríticas diferentes: VMWare Player es ligeramente más sencillo de instalar pero no puede crear MVs, mientras que VMWare Server permite tener múltiples MVs.
MEPIS 7.0
VMware no está en los repositorios de Debian Etch por lo que no se puede instalar usando Synaptic. Descargar el paquete de esta página. Una vez se tenga el paquete, se puede instalar VMware Server siguiendo las instrucciones para 6.5 a continuación. También se puede usar este método alternativo (en)
MEPIS 6.5
Installación
- Prerequisito: Instalar las cabeceras del kernel
VMWare Player
- VMWare Player está disponible en Synaptic, buscar "vmware" e instalar todos lo paquetes que se encuentren.
- Ejecutar como superusuario en konsole
vmware-config.pl
VMWare Server
- Descargar el tarball para Linux (También es necesario 'registrarse' para obtner un número de serie gratuito)
- Descomprimir el fichero descargado
- Abrir la carpeta creaday presionar F4 para abrir konsole en dicho directorio
- Conectarse como superusuario y escribir:
./vmware-install.pl
Configuración
vmware-config.pl es el script de configuración para VMWare. Seguir las indicaciones, en caso de tener dudas aceptar los valores por defecto.
[Nota: Al instalar VMWARE-server, se pide un 'número de serie'. Se puede obtener uno de forma gratuita registrandose en la misma página dónde se descargo el tarball.]
Crear Maquinas Virtuales
VMWare Server y Workstation tienen una opción sencilla para crear MVs. VMWare Player no tiene dicha funcionalidad dado que está concebido simplemente para ejecutar aplicaciones existentes, sin embargo se pueden crear MVs para él con ayuda de: http://www.easyvmx.com/ También es posible crear una MV a partir de un ordenador real para ejecutar Windows en un equipo Linux, ver conversor VMWare para Linux (en).
Tras la creación de cada MV se puede proceder a instalar el sistema operativo en la maquina virtual. Así por ejemplo para ejecutar Windows en una MV en MEPIS usando VMWare-Server, abrir 'VMWare Server Console', conectar de forma local y seleccionar la opción 'crear una nueva máquina virtual'. Seleccionar el sistema operativo que se va a instalar (por ej. WinXP Pro) y crear una MV para él. Después usar la opción 'encender esta máquina virtual', y debería intentar arrancar, pero dado que ningún sistema operativo se ha instalado todavía, VMWare-server debeía pedir que se introdujese un CD de instalación para el sistema operativo (por ej. WinXP Pro).
Cabe destacar que se puede instalar otra distribución de Linux además de Windows en la máquina virtual. También es posible instalar otros sistemas operativos.
Ejecutando MEPIS (virtual) en VMWare
Hay que seleccionar IDE en vez de SATA cuando se pregunte por el tipo de disco duro virtual a crear. Si se ha instalado usando SATA se tendrá que seleccionar la opcióninitrd, o añadir la depues la línea en /menu/grub/menu.lst.
Resolución de problemas
- Si con Mepis 7.0 64bit las fuentes y los símbolos no son detectados por VMware una solución es añador una variable de entorno (por ejemplo en /etc/profile, ~/.bashrc, ...)
export VMWARE_USE_SHIPPED_GTK=force

